首页> 外文会议>Proceedings of the 2006 ACM/IEEE international symposium on Empirical software engineering >An industrial case study of structural testing applied to safety-critical embedded software
【24h】

An industrial case study of structural testing applied to safety-critical embedded software

机译:结构测试应用于安全关键型嵌入式软件的工业案例研究

获取原文
获取原文并翻译 | 示例
获取外文期刊封面目录资料

摘要

Effective testing of safety-critical real-time embedded software is difficult and expensive. Many companies are hesitant about the cost of formalized criteria-based testing and are not convinced of the benefits. This paper presents the results of an industrial case study that compared the normal testing at a company (manual functional testing) with testing based on the logic-based criterion of correlated active clause coverage (CACC). The evaluation was performed during the testing of embedded, real-time control software that has been deployed in a safety-critical application in the transportation industry. We found in our study that the test cases generated to satisfy the CACC criterion detected major safety-critical faults that were not detected by functional testing. We also found that the cost required for CACC testing was not necessarily higher than the cost of functional testing. There were also several faults that were found by the functional tests that were not found by CACC tests.
机译:对安全至关重要的实时嵌入式软件进行有效测试既困难又昂贵。许多公司对正式的基于标准的测试的成本犹豫不决,并且不相信这样做的好处。本文介绍了一个工业案例研究的结果,该案例将公司的正常测试(手动功能测试)与基于基于逻辑的相关活动条款覆盖范围(CACC)标准的测试进行了比较。评估是在嵌入式实时控制软件的测试过程中进行的,该软件已部署在交通运输行业中对安全性至关重要的应用中。我们在研究中发现,为满足CACC标准而生成的测试用例检测到了主要的安全关键故障,而功能测试并未检测到这些故障。我们还发现,CACC测试所需的成本不一定高于功能测试的成本。功能测试还发现了一些故障,而CACC测试未发现这些故障。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号